Choosing an espresso machine is about more than chasing the highest pressure number on the box. The real differences show up in shot consistency, how quickly the boiler heats, how much control you get over milk texture, and whether the daily routine is simple enough that you actually use the machine. A great espresso setup should reward you with cafe-quality results without turning every morning into a science experiment.
When you compare espresso machines, focus on the fundamentals: stable temperature, a usable steam wand, a portafilter that holds a proper dose, and a build that resists wobble during extraction. Bundled grinders and PID temperature control add convenience but also cost and complexity, so weigh them against your skill level and counter space. The goal is a machine that fits your habits, not just one that wins a spec sheet.

Key buying factors
Marketing numbers like 20 bar refer to the pump's maximum, not what hits the coffee. The puck only needs around 9 bar for ideal extraction, so a higher rated pump simply means there is headroom. Prioritize stable, well-regulated pressure over the biggest advertised figure.
Consistent water temperature is the single biggest driver of shot quality. Machines with PID control or thermojet style heating hold a tighter range than basic thermoblocks. If you pull multiple shots back to back, stable temperature recovery matters even more.
If you drink lattes or cappuccinos, the steam wand defines your experience. Look for a wand with enough power and reach to create microfoam, not just bubbly froth. Manual wands give more control while automatic frothers prioritize convenience.
An integrated grinder, like the one on the Breville Barista Express, streamlines the workflow and saves counter space. A separate grinder usually offers more grind precision and flexibility but adds cost and another appliance to manage. Beginners often benefit from an all-in-one.
A 54mm or 58mm portafilter with proper baskets gives you room for a full dose and better extraction than tiny pressurized baskets. Pressurized baskets are forgiving for beginners, while non-pressurized baskets reward good grinding and tamping. Check which baskets are included.
Counter space, water tank access, and drip tray cleaning all affect how much you enjoy the machine. Compact models suit small kitchens, while larger machines often add capacity and stability. Make sure the water reservoir is easy to refill without moving the whole unit.

Best for: First-time buyers wanting an easy, fast introduction to home espresso.Care & usage tips
Run several blank shots of just hot water through the portafilter and group head before your first real shot to heat the system and rinse manufacturing residue. Fill the tank with filtered water to reduce scale, and let the machine reach full temperature before pulling, since cold metal robs heat from the extraction.
After each session, purge and wipe the steam wand immediately so milk does not bake on, and knock out the puck and rinse the basket. Weekly, backflush machines that support it and soak the portafilter and baskets to clear coffee oils that cause bitter, stale flavors.
Descale on the schedule your manual recommends, more often if you have hard water, to keep heating elements and flow rates healthy. Replace any water filter cartridges on time and check seals and gaskets periodically, as worn group gaskets cause leaks and pressure loss.
The grinder usually matters more than the espresso machine itself. Even a capable brewer cannot fix grounds that are too coarse, too fine, or inconsistent, which is why an all-in-one like the Breville Barista Express often outperforms a pricier machine paired with a cheap grinder. If your budget is fixed, invest in grind quality before chasing exotic machine features.
Always pre-heat your portafilter and cup with hot water before pulling a shot, because cold metal and ceramic drain heat from the coffee and flatten the flavor.
Frequently asked questions
Does higher bar pressure mean better espresso?+
Not directly. The puck only needs about 9 bar for ideal extraction, so a 20-bar pump simply has extra headroom. Stable temperature and a good grind matter far more than the maximum pressure rating.
Do I need a built-in grinder?+
It depends on your setup. An all-in-one like the Breville Barista Express saves space and streamlines workflow, but a separate grinder can offer more precision. Beginners often appreciate the convenience of an integrated grinder.
Can these machines froth milk for lattes and cappuccinos?+
Yes. All the machines featured include a steam wand or frothing system for milk drinks. Manual wands give you more control over microfoam, while automatic frothers prioritize ease of use.
How often should I descale my espresso machine?+
Follow your manual, but a general rule is every one to three months depending on water hardness. Using filtered water slows scale buildup and extends the time between descaling sessions.
